Geography
Horbova is in the country of Ukraine[6]. Located in include Hertsa Raion[4], a raion of Ukraine[22], in Ukraine[23], founded in 1991[24] and Chernivtsi Raion[5], a raion of Ukraine[25], in Ukraine[26], founded in 2020[27]. Horbova is on the body of water Molnytsia[7].
